  6. I setup a 55 gallon small predator tank about 6 months ago. The problem is, predators eat the normal clean up crew invertebrates. I have a starry blenny in there to help with algae but he's not doing a very good job. I had put a long spine urchin in there but the bluespot puffer I have started eating the spines off of him so I put the urchin in my display tank. Are there any other CUC creatures I could try to help control algae? Maybe a starfish? I'm not sure if the puffer would eat the starfish.

  14. All are great stores. AquaDome has a more diverse selection of livestock that AquaTek and River City. River City has a great hardware selection in terms of tanks. AquaTek has a great selection of accessories and buffs. AquaTek also has some more "rare" selections than AquaDome. All in all though they are all great stores and their staffs are very helpful and knowledgable.
